696 282 339

🕒 TocTime Online – Versión 1.2.5 22/04/2026

Novedades y mejoras

Se ha añadido dos opciones en el apartado de configuración de impresión de listados.

1 Redondear si el fichaje está dentro del margen de cortesía

Se aplica solo a empleados con horario predeterminado o calendario asignado con horarios seguidos o partidos.

Ejemplo: Entrada prevista 09:00:00 con margen de 00:05:00. Si el empleado ficha a 08:58:00 o 09:01:00, la hora se ajusta a 09:00:00 para el cómputo.

Cuando esta opción está activa:

  • Se añade una columna con las horas redondeadas.
  • Se mantiene igualmente la columna con las horas originales sin redondear.
  • En los listados que utilizan calendario, la columna de Balance de horas se calculará mediante la columna de Horas trabajadas totales con redondeo en vez de hacerlo con la de horas trabajadas normales.

Si los fichajes están fuera del margen (sin redondeo) o si el redondeo es de apenas unos segundos, ambas columnas pueden mostrar la misma hora o existir una diferencia no apreciable si no se activa la opción mostrar segundos.

2 Ignorar cómputo de horas para fichajes incorrectos

Esta opción permite excluir del cálculo de horas aquellos fichajes que hayan sido marcados como incorrectos desde la pantalla de mantenimiento. Los fichajes ignorados:

  • no se muestran en el listado
  • no participan en el cómputo de horas
  • permiten resolver incidencias sin modificar horas manualmente ni añadir fichajes artificiales

Es una forma más sencilla, limpia y segura de corregir errores habituales en el registro de fichajes.

Cómo funciona el sistema de forma nativa (sin esta opción)

Cuando el programa detecta dos fichajes consecutivos del mismo tipo (por ejemplo, dos entradas seguidas), aplica siempre la misma regla:

👉 solo tiene en cuenta el último fichaje del tipo repetido

Ejemplo real:

  • Entrada correcta: 09:00:00
  • Entrada repetida por error: 10:00:00
  • Salida: 12:00:00

El sistema interpreta:

  • Entrada válida → 10:00:00
  • Salida válida → 12:00:00

Resultado:

  • 2 horas trabajadas, en lugar de las 3 horas reales

El primer fichaje de entrada (09:00:00) queda automáticamente descartado.

Cómo se solucionaba este problema antes

La única forma de corregirlo era ajustar manualmente la hora del fichaje repetido.

Por ejemplo:

  • Cambiar la entrada errónea de 10:00:00 a 09:00:01

De esta manera, el sistema:

  • ignoraba la entrada de las 09:00:00
  • tomaba como válida la de 09:00:01
  • y el cálculo resultaba correcto

Este método sigue funcionando, pero es más laborioso y requiere modificar datos reales.

Cómo se soluciona ahora (método recomendado)

Con la opción Ignorar cómputo de horas para fichajes incorrectos, puedes simplemente:

👉 marcar el fichaje repetido como incorrecto

El sistema entonces:

  • ignora ese fichaje por completo
  • conserva el fichaje correcto
  • calcula las horas sin necesidad de editar nada

Es una forma más rápida, segura y transparente de resolver incidencias.

3 ✔ Mostrar al final un listado de fichajes incorrectos

Si esta opción está activa, el listado incluirá una sección final con todos los fichajes que han sido:

  • marcados como incorrectos
  • y por tanto excluidos del cálculo

Importante: Si esta opción está activada pero la opción Ignorar fichajes incorrectos está desactivada, no se mostrará nada, ya que no hay fichajes ignorados que listar.

🎯 Mejoras y solución de problemas

 
Se ha corregido el error en la pantalla de configuración de impresión en el cual los campos para establecer el tamaño de fuente y la altura de las filas de los listados estaba invertido.

Se ha corregido un problema en los listados que no mostraba correctamente los días de la semana para los últimos días del mes de febrero y provocaba repeticiones y confusión.

Se han realizado pequeñas mejoras de rendimiento y apariencia.